The optimization of infrastructure planning in a multimodal network is defined as a multiobjective network design problem, with accessibility, use of urban space by parking, operating deficit and climate impact as objectives. This paper describes a scalable algorithm for solving multiobjective decomposable problems by combining the hierarchical Bayesian optimization algorithm (hBOA) with the nondominated sorting genetic algorithm (NSGA-II) and clustering in the objective space. Controllers design problems are multi objective optimization problems as the controller must satisfy several performance measures that are often conflicting and competing with each other. In multi-objective approach a set of solutions can be generated from which the designer can select a final solution according to his requirement and need. Cooperative coevolutionary evolutionary algorithms differ from standard evolutionary algorithms architecture in that the population is split into subpopulations, each of them optimising only a subvector of the global solution vector. This paper summarizes the implementation and performance of Nondominated Sorting Genetic algorithm (NSGA-II) [2] for feature selection of remotely sensed hyperspectral imagery. Two step processes have been followed. In first step, a feature subset is selected with optimum spectral and texture information content resulting in a smaller space to be searched in the next step.
